Timeline

  1. Analyst Downgrade

    Susquehanna reduces its price target for JD stock following review of margin pressures.

  2. Macau Campaign

    Launch of a RMB 200 million voucher program to stimulate cross-border e-commerce.

  3. Official UK Launch

    Joybuy goes live for all UK consumers with a full range of electronics, home goods, and apparel.

  4. European Expansion

    JD.com launches Joybuy platform in the UK and Europe to challenge Amazon.

  5. Quarterly Earnings Report

    JD.com posts its first quarterly loss in nearly four years, citing delivery competition.

  6. UK Beta Testing

    Joybuy begins limited beta testing with select UK-based merchants and influencers.

  7. Logistics Expansion

    JD.com increases its warehousing footprint in Poland and Germany to support European fulfillment.

  8. European Entry

    JD.com launches Ochama automated stores in the Netherlands.
